1. History and development of Online Poker Ranking:

Online poker ranking systems very first appeared during the early 2000s, soon after the poker increase. Back then, systems like Sharkscope and formal Poker Rankings (OPR) attained appeal by monitoring and showing players’ competition results and earnings. These systems mostly dedicated to supplying statistics to simply help players analyze their overall performance and get a benefit over their opponents.

However, as on-line poker became more competitive, ranking systems began incorporating extra elements like leaderboard competitions and player score systems. This change directed to foster a feeling of competitiveness, pushing people to strive for greater positioning and recognition from their colleagues.

2. Different Sorts Of On-line Poker Ranking Systems:

These days, players get access to various on-line poker ranking systems that use diverse methodologies in assessing players' performances. Although some systems concentrate on cash online game outcomes, other individuals prioritize competition accomplishments or a combination of both.

One popular ranking system may be the Global Poker Index (GPI), which attained widespread recognition due to its unbiased and accurate analysis methods. The GPI uses a scoring formula that weighs in at tournaments' buy-ins, industry dimensions, and players' finishing jobs. Consequently, the machine presents a target ranking that ranks people predicated on their particular consistent overall performance in prestigious real time tournaments.

Furthermore, online systems eg PocketFives and Sharkscope offer rankings predicated on players' on line competition shows exclusively. These systems monitor players' outcomes across multiple on-line poker web sites, permitting people to compare their particular performance against other individuals within the online poker community.

3. Implications of Internet Poker Ranking:

Online poker ranking systems have manifold ramifications for players, providers, as well as the general poker community. Firstly, these methods foster competition, as players attempt to rise up the positioning ladder, eventually boosting the overall skill level associated with player share. Furthermore, ranking systems motivate people to boost their particular gameplay, study methods, and devote more hours and energy to online poker.

For operators, on-line poker ranking methods act as an advertising tool to entice even more players. By showcasing the accomplishments of high-ranking players in online tournaments, operators can cause a very good neighborhood and produce a competitive environment that motivates involvement.

But is important to notice that internet poker ranking systems are not without their particular limits. The methods mostly target players' tournament activities and might not precisely mirror their general abilities in all poker alternatives. Moreover, some people may adjust their ranks by playing discerning tournaments or exploiting the machine's defects, undermining the competitive stability of online poker.
